Taking on the Bakery/Deli Clerk role at Fry's Food Stores means stepping into a fast-paced environment where customer satisfaction is key. Candidates should be ready to engage directly with customers to fulfill their needs, making strong communication skills a must.
This position also emphasizes compliance with health and safety standards, requiring employees to obtain a food handlers permit shortly after being hired. It’s crucial to be aware of this requirement, as it adds an extra layer of responsibility.
while the role offers flexibility in scheduling, it can also involve irregular hours, especially during peak shopping times like holidays. This can be a challenge for those seeking a consistent work-life balance.
